This test measures the total level of acid phosphatase, an enzyme found in various tissues but particularly concentrated in the prostate gland. Historically used to screen for prostate cancer, it now has broader applications. The test can help assess prostate health, evaluate certain bone disorders, and monitor the progression of some cancers. It’s also useful in following up on abnormal prostate-specific antigen (PSA) results and assessing the effectiveness of treatments for prostate conditions.
